Influence of crystal growth conditions and carbothermal treatment on activator charge state in Ti:sapphire
Presented are the results of comparative studies of the influence of carbothermal treatment of the raw material (Al₂O₃ and TiO₂ powders) and reducing properties of the growth medium on the charge state of titanium ions in Al₂O₃:Ti crystals.
